Banana Delight

  1. Mix together KeeblerGraham Cracker Crumbs, suger and melted butter in a bowl.  Sprinkle hald of crumb mixture in each of wight 10-oz custer cups or dessert dishes (approximately 2 1/2 tablspoons mixture in each dish.)  Reserve remaining crumb mixture.  Place half of banana sliced over crumb mixture in dishes.  Reserve ramaining banana slices.
  2. Combine pudding mix and mild in large bowl; beat with a wire whisk for 2 minutes.  Spoon hald of pudding over bananas in each dish (approximatiley 2 tablespoons puddingin each dish).  Top each with an additional 2 1/2 tablespoons crumb mixture and remaining bananas.
  3. Cover bananas with whipped topping (a heat 1/4 cup in each dish.)  Chill at least 15 minutes.  Before serving, garnish with sliced bananas dipped in limon juice, if desired.  Makes 8 servings.
 
 

Ingredients:

 1 1/2 cups    Keebler Graham Cracker Crumbs

1/4 cup           sugar

6 Tbsp            butter, melted

5                       large bananas, cut into 1/4" slices

2 pkags           (3.4oz) banana cream floavor instant pudding & pie filling

3 cups              cold milk

1 tub                    (8oz) frozen, non dairy whipped topping, thawed
